投稿日 | : 2006/08/20(Sun) 16:14 |
投稿者 | : ムーニー |
Eメール | : |
URL | : |
タイトル | : 各コントロールのIndexを取得することは可能でしょうか? |
こんにちわ。いつもお世話になっております。
タイトルにも書きましたが、各コントロールのIndex(TabIndexの値など)を取得する
ことは可能ですか?アクティブなコントロールが何であるかとを判別できますでしょうか。
スプレッドコントロールがあって、3つのボタン(「作成」、「クリア」、「閉じる」)が
あるアプリで、スプレッドのLeaveCellイベントで入力チェックを行っています。
スプレッド上でたとえば”A/B/C”のようにスラッシュが2個以上ある場合はエラーとして
メッセージを表示する処理をLeaveCellイベントに書きました。
ですが、この場合、「クリア」ボタンや「閉じる」ボタンを押したときにもエラーMSGが
表示されちゃいます。これは使い勝手が悪いので、「クリア」、「閉じる」にフォーカスが
遷移したときはエラーチェックが入らないようにしたいのですが。。。
可能でしょうか。